原文:為什么j2EE應用,接口實際使用,多於抽象類

我想,有很多朋友和我一樣,肯定也發現了這個問題,為什么J EE應用中,接口的使用量遠遠超過抽象類 記得在學校時,Java教材專門用了好幾頁來講兩者的區別,老師也抽出幾節課的時間,和我們着重講解接口和抽象類。看似懂了的我,實際卻並不懂,就像這里提出的問題。 其實,無論對於接口,或者是抽象類,都是要求子類將本類中定義的方法實現,區別也僅僅是接口要求全部實現,抽象類中的非抽象方法不一定要重寫。對於接口 ...

2012-09-03 13:38 5 2412 推薦指數:

查看詳情

J2EE WEB應用架構分析

1. 架構概述 J2EE體系包括java server pages(JSP) ,java SERVLET, enterprise bean,WEB service等技術。這些技術的出現給電子商務時代的WEB應用程序的開發提供了一個非常有競爭力的選擇。怎樣把這些技術組合起來形成一個適應項目需要 ...

Tue Jan 30 23:01:00 CST 2018 0 1437
抽象類接口

抽象類   抽象類(abstractclass):在中聲明一個方法,這個方法沒有實現體,是一個“空”方法。這樣的稱為抽象類,在頭用abstract修飾符表示。   抽象方法(abstract method):只有方法聲明,而沒有具體方法體的方法。這樣的方法稱為抽象方法。在方法頭 ...

Mon Sep 17 03:10:00 CST 2018 3 586
抽象類接口

抽象類 abstract修飾符 1.abstract修飾的抽象類,此類不能有對象,(無法對此類進行實例化,說白了就是不能new); 2.abstract修飾的方法為抽象方法,此方法不能有方法體(就是什么內容不能有); 關於抽象類使用特點: 1.抽象類不能有對象,(不能用 ...

Mon Jul 15 19:18:00 CST 2019 0 2626
接口抽象類

接口interface的作用 接口是對於行為的抽象,在小項目、小設計中接口帶來的好處可能不會特別明顯,但是項目一旦龐大起來,接口的優勢就很明顯會體現出來了: 1、對於一個龐大的項目,從設計的角度來說,接口的存在可以幫助理清楚業務,利用接口不僅可以告訴開發人員需要實現哪些業務,而且也將命名規范 ...

Wed Oct 21 04:42:00 CST 2015 1 2221
什么是接口抽象類

謹記:設計嚴謹的軟件重要的標准就是需要經的起測試,一個程序好不好被測試,測試發現問題能不能被良好的修復,程序狀況能否被監控,這都有賴於對抽象類接口的正確使用接口抽象類,是高階面向對象設計的起點。想要學習設計模式,必須有着對抽象類接口的良好認知,和SOLID的認知,並在日常工作中 ...

Tue Oct 12 07:39:00 CST 2021 0 97
Java抽象類接口的概念和使用

1.抽象類 在自上而下的繼承層次結構中,位於上層的更具有通用性,甚至可能更加抽象。從某種角度看,祖先更加通用,它只包含一些最基本的成員,人們只將它作為派生其他的基類,而不會用來創建對象。甚至,你可以只給出方法的定義而不實現,由子類根據具體需求來具體實現。 這種只給出方法定義而不具體實現 ...

Thu Sep 02 05:58:00 CST 2021 0 106
Java 為什么使用抽象類接口

Java接口和Java抽象類代表的就是抽象類型,就是我們需要提出的抽象層的具體表現。OOP面向對象的編程,如果要提高程序的復用率,增加程序的可維護性,可擴展性,就必須是面向接口的編程,面向抽象的編程,正確地使用接口抽象類這些太有用的抽象類型做為你結構層次上的頂層。 1、Java接口 ...

Sat Oct 25 21:14:00 CST 2014 0 2620
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M